Account Manager, Mid Market

Manages a mid-market customer portfolio, driving product adoption, renewals, and expansion revenue through consultative relationships. The role requires at least three years of B2B SaaS sales experience, strong pipeline discipline, and regular attendance at the London office.

About the job

Responsibilities

  • Identify and close expansion opportunities within Tier 1 and Tier 2 mid-market accounts.
  • Conduct virtual and in-person customer meetings, including enablement, product activation sessions, and business reviews.
  • Own a portfolio of customers, maintaining strong organization and seeing customer situations through to resolution.
  • Collaborate with Customer Success, Support, Marketing, Legal, and Product teams to ensure a seamless customer experience.
  • Drive upsell, cross-sell, and upgrade revenue through a consultative, trusted-advisor approach.
  • Build relationships with executive sponsors and day-to-day operators.
  • Maintain data-driven pipeline decisions and revenue predictability.
  • Explore product capabilities to uncover expansion opportunities.
  • Surface customer feedback to help influence product direction.
  • Meet or exceed monthly revenue targets.
  • Develop and maintain 3x pipeline coverage based on a 40% win rate.
  • Create account plans for the top 20% of the account portfolio.
  • Analyze account usage to identify product activation and adoption opportunities.
  • Conduct customer meetings and account touches at the required pace.
  • Work from the London WeWork office three days per week.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ience in B2B SaaS sales.
  • Proven record of consistently meeting monthly or quarterly revenue targets.
  • Experience developing 3x pipeline coverage through inbound leads and targeted account planning.
  • Experience identifying additional use cases and expansion opportunities.
  • Experience working cross-functionally with Customer Success, Support, Marketing, Legal, and Product teams.
  • Customer-centric approach and ability to thrive in ambiguity and change.
